Epicor CRS shows its retail products at UK's largest conference and exhibition dedicated to the use of retail technology
Epicor CRS, the Retail Solutions Division of Epicor Software, a leading provider of enterprise business software solutions to the midmarket and divisions of Global 1000 companies, has announced it will be showcasing its suite of retail solutions at Retail Solutions 2007, the UK's largest conference and expo dedicated to the use of technology within the retail, hospitality and leisure industries The show features more than 200 exhibitors, as well as speakers from some of the industry's highest profile retailers who convene to share their experiences of how technology has helped to grow their businesses and add financial value

Epicor will be demonstrating its Epicor CRS Retail Suite, including the CRS RetailStore 3.0 point-of-sale (POS) solution, a highly configurable application based on the Microsoft .NET platform and designed to work standalone or as an integral part of the end-to-end Retail Suite.
A leader in store operations and enterprise software services for specialty retailers, Epicor CRS currently serves approximately 140 customers worldwide, including 15 of the top 100 specialty retailers such as Cache, Chico's, Claire's, Coach, GNC, JCrew, Rosebys, Shoefayre and Zumiez.
Epicor CRS provides real-time store and multi-channel management solutions for retailers that seek to optimise each customer touch point across all available sales channels, including stores, online and catalog operations.

These solutions help retailers integrate their sales channels, order management, inventory and other operations in order to have the right information at the right time, including store-level business intelligence.
"Many UK and European-based retailers are growing and expanding," said Kathy Frommer, senior vice president and general manager of Epicor CRS.
"Our suite of retail solutions offers an integrated, host-to-post experience from point-of-sale to the corporate office, This allows us to support their retail needs today, and scale to support their global aspirations".
Epicor CRS's presence at Retail Solutions 2007 marks the first time the company has had a presence at the show, and underscores the company's efforts to grow its retail presence in the UK and Europe.
To date, Epicor's go-to-market efforts in the region have proved extremely fruitful.
Its manufacturing solution continues to build momentum with very strong double digit growth in UK sales over the past year.
Additionally, its iScala solutions are well represented across its customer base of more than 20,000 customers in more than 140 countries.
